Description

The McIntosh MCD600 is McIntosh's premium two-channel SACD/CD player and DAC — the tier below the MCD12000 flagship, without Hybrid Drive but built around the same premium 8-channel 32-bit PCM/DSD Quad Balanced DAC architecture (four DAC channels dedicated to each audio channel) that appears across McIntosh's serious digital sources. All PCM signals are up-sampled to 32-bit/384 kHz internally before analog conversion.

The output configuration is where the MCD600 pulls ahead of the MCD350 in system flexibility. Both fixed and variable balanced/unbalanced analog outputs are provided — the variable outputs, combined with McIntosh's digital volume control, let the MCD600 connect directly to a power amplifier for a two-component all-digital system that skips the preamplifier entirely. Coax and optical digital outputs are provided for sending the digital signal to an external DAC or processor, and coax and optical digital inputs let the MCD600 serve as a DAC for external streamers or CD transports. A High Drive headphone amplifier is built in, optimized for the full range of headphone impedances.

Playback covers SACD, CD, CD-R/RW, and DVD-R data discs, and a front-panel USB input handles USB flash drives with support for AAC, AIFF, ALAC, DSD (up to DSD128), FLAC, MP3, WAV (up to 24-bit/192 kHz), and WMA files. Twin laser optical pickup, 2x read speed with buffer memory for error correction, precision die-cast aluminum disc tray.

Featured Specs

General Specs

Configuration

Two-channel premium SACD/CD player and full-featured DAC — the tier below the MCD12000 flagship

DAC

Premium 8-channel 32-bit PCM/DSD Quad Balanced DAC — four DAC channels dedicated to each audio channel

Internal Upsampling

All PCM signals upsampled to 32-bit/384 kHz before analog conversion

Analog Outputs

Fixed AND variable balanced XLR + unbalanced RCA — the variable outputs with digital volume control allow direct connection to a power amplifier

Digital Inputs

Coax and optical (accept external streamers, transports, or other digital sources)

Digital Outputs

Coax and optical (route MCD600's digital signal to an external DAC or processor)

Playback Media

SACD, CD, CD-R/RW, DVD-R data discs; front-panel USB flash drives

File Formats

AAC, AIFF, ALAC, DSD (up to DSD128), FLAC, MP3, WAV (up to 24-bit/192 kHz), WMA

Headphone Amplifier

High Drive section with 1/4-inch output — optimized for the full headphone impedance range

Disc Mechanism

Twin laser optical pickup, 2x read speed with buffer memory, precision die-cast aluminum tray

Application

Premium disc player for SACD/CD collectors who also want a McIntosh DAC for external digital sources — the tier below the MCD12000 (which adds Hybrid Drive tube outputs and seven digital inputs)
